Department Stores nearby Wilmer Way, London N14 7HY, United Kingdom

Marks & Spencer Pinkham Way Southgate BP

Approximately 0.99 km away
Address: North Circular Road, London, United Kingdom

Peacocks Stores Plc

Approximately 1.17 km away
Address: 68 The Mall, London N14 6LN, United Kingdom

Catalogue Bargain Shop

Approximately 1.17 km away
Address: 252 Green Lanes, London N13 5TU, United Kingdom

Halfords

Approximately 1.31 km away
Address: Unit F, Friern Bridge Retail Park, Pegasus Way, London N11 3PW, United Kingdom